Morpeth to Scarborough

Updated: 28 May 2026

The journey from Morpeth to the seaside town of Scarborough is approximately 110 miles. By car, you will take the A1(M) south and then the A64, taking about 2 hours 30 minutes. By train, you can travel from Morpeth to Scarborough, usually requiring changes in Newcastle and York. This is a longer journey but takes you to one of the UK's most famous coastal resorts.

Things to Do in Scarborough
1
Scarborough Castle
A historic castle with stunning views over the North Sea.
2
South Bay Beach
A classic sandy beach with traditional seaside amusements.
3
Sea Life Scarborough
A popular aquarium featuring a variety of marine life.
4
Peasholm Park
A beautiful oriental-themed park with boating and events.
